I am Caucasian with very thick, coarse and bushy, spiral-curly hair underneath and looser, less spirally curly hair on top. It is not thin or fine anywhere on my head, and it has various types of curl throughout (spiral, wavy, kinky, and weirdly, almost straight)-- and lots and lots and lots of frizz. I can only use this right after washing my hair. If I try to put it in my 2nd or 3rd day, unwashed hair, it can feel too thick and stiff, and does not perform the same as when put in wet. It really helps hold the curl pattern and reduce frizz, though I still do use Frizz ease or another silicone/dimethicone product as my hair has no natural shine due to its coarseness/roughness. I do not have issues with silicones or derivatives, as my hair is so very thick--if it were fine or fragile, I would not use them. I air dry and never blow dry; I do not straighten or flat iron my hair. I do not use curlers or rollers of any kind. Not for everyday--maybe once in a while for a special occasion. Leave-in condish is a great addition to my hair-care arsenal. It is not too expensive, lasts a long time and does not have an unpleasant smell. I do not break out on my hands or head when using this regularly, which happens often enough with other products I have used.

First I would like to say I am comparing this product to the one I normally use, Aubrey Organics - Calaguala Fern Hair Thick/Conditioner. My hair type is in between 3b & 3c, and I live in the northeastern US; it can get pretty humid, and I live near the city. I think how your hair reacts not only depends on the products you use, but also the environment in which you live. I tried this product for about a month. It does the job; my hair was smooth, frizz free, and made my hair soft, but it weighed my curls down a bit. I like to have a lot of volume with my curls, and the other product is lighter on my hair. Also, after using Miss Jessie's for awhile, I noticed I had to wash my hair more often. I had much more build up with this product. At the end of the day, my hair would be drier too; as with my usual product, my hair stayed softer. I got this product because it's cheaper than Aubrey, and I heard good things about it, so I thought I'd give it a try. It's good for a sleek look once in while, but I think I'll just go back to Aubrey for my everyday use. The overall health of my hair was better with Aubrey while still keeping a frizz free healthy look.
